Fox Rent A Car recently expanded its location at the San Jose Mineta International Airport (SJC), following growth in the company’s market share.
The branch has added a wider variety of fleet vehicles, including premium and eco-friendly models.
It also installed ready-line spaces to speed up service and reduce customer wait times. The company streamlined its rental process by investing in technology and service improvements at SJC and received higher customer satisfaction scores.
With this growth, Fox Rent A Car can compete more strongly in the San Jose market, offering its value and convenience to a growing customer base.
Looking ahead, Fox plans to grow further in the Bay Area, adding more vehicles and enhancing customer service.
“As we’ve grown our presence at SJC, we’ve focused on making sure every customer feels the impact of that growth, whether it’s through faster service, expanded vehicle choices or simply demonstrating how much we value their time,” said David Walker, senior director of West region operations for Fox Rent A Car, in a Nov. 14 news release. “Expanding here has been about more than just adding cars. It’s about deepening our connection to the Bay Area and providing an experience that leaves a lasting impression.”
